Two rescued pangolins sit in a basket during a news conference in Bangkok on June 7, 2012. Thai customs rescued 110 pangolins worth about $35,500 that they say were to be sold outside the country as exotic food. The animals, hidden in a pickup truck, were seized at a customs checkpoint in Prachuap Khiri Khan province, south of Bangkok. (Photo by Sakchai Lalit/Associated Press)

Four-year-old Etta Syrett relaxes on one of two giant pumpkins at Pinetops Nurseries in Lymington, UK on September 22, 2025, affectionately named “Dumbledore” and ”Muggle”. Grown by twins Ian and Stuart Paton, each weighs an estimated 1,179 kg (2,600 lbs). The 64-year-old brothers were inspired by Hagrid’s pumpkin patch in Harry Potter and hope to break the world record. (Photo by Ollie Thompson/Solent News & Photo Agency)
